The new Minister of Tourism for Spain is Hector Gomez from Tenerife

The Spanish Prime Minister, Pedro Sánchez, has announced two changes to his cabinet this morning (Monday) because the current Minister of Tourism, Reyes Maroto, and the Minister of Health, Carolina Darias, are stepping down from their roles.

Sanchez has confirmed that the new Minister of Tourism is Héctor Gómez while José Manuel Miñones will take over as the Minister of Health. Maroto and Darias have both departed to be candidates for the municipal elections on May 28th, with Darias running as Mayor of Las Palmas in Gran Canaria.

Héctor Gómez was born in Santa Cruz de Tenerife on 16th November 1978, and was brought up in Guia de Isora in the south of Tenerife. Between 2017 and 2021, he was the Secretary of International Relations of the Federal Executive Commission of the PSOE, and between 2021 and 2022 he was spokesman for the PSOE in the Congress of Deputies, and until today, he was the president of the Constitutional Commission of the Congress of Deputies.
